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Задание значения элементу вектора -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Почему ругается на не объявленный идентификатор http://www.cyberforum.ru/cpp-beginners/thread301871.html
#include<iostream> #include<time.h> #include<stdio.h> #include<conio.h> using namespace std; int main() { int mas,i,n,a,temp;
C++ Удаление знака из конца строки. Здравствуйте, требуется ваша помощь. Есть программа, которая считывает английский текст из файла и выводит на экран слова, начинающиеся с гласных букв. Так вот, если в конце слова стоит знак, то... http://www.cyberforum.ru/cpp-beginners/thread301854.html
C++ Описать класс, реализующий бинарное дерево
Описать класс, реализующий бинарное дерево, обладающее возможностью добавления новых элементов, удаления существующих, поиска элемента по ключу, а также последовательного доступа ко всем элементам....
C++ подправить двумерные массивы
Осуществить циклический сдвиг элементов прямоугольной матрицы на N элементов вправо или вниз (в зависимости от введенного режима). N может быть больше количества элементов в строке или столбце. у...
C++ Вычисление определённых интегралов http://www.cyberforum.ru/cpp-beginners/thread301841.html
Подскажите, пожалуйста, в чём ошибка. файл с методами вычисления #include "stdafx.h" #include "Integ.h" #include "iostream" #include "cmath" #include "conio.h"
C++ Метод перебора. Задание: Написать программу для поиска экстремума функцие методом перебора. Алгоритм: Шаг1. Выбрать начальный шаг sh=(b-a)/4. Положить x0=a. Вычислить F(x0). Шаг2. Положить x1=x0+sh. Вычислить... подробнее

Показать сообщение отдельно
ovoshlook
3 / 3 / 0
Регистрация: 22.05.2010
Сообщений: 77

Задание значения элементу вектора - C++

22.05.2011, 14:53. Просмотров 269. Ответов 0
Метки (Все метки)

Здравствуйте все!
Проблема следующего характера:
Элементу вектора с определенным индексом мне нужно присвоить определенное значение.
Делаю я это так:

Определю размер вектора: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
void OTS_MainWindow::AddTabForQuestion(QTabWidget *TabWidget)
 
{
    MainTabWidget       =new QWidget;
    MainTabVBoxLayout   =new QVBoxLayout;
 
 
    GlobalVaribles::NumberOfTab++;
    /*Определяю размер вектора:*/
    GlobalVaribles::SummOfTabAndTypeOfQuestionForCurrentTab.resize(GlobalVaribles::NumberOfTab);
 
    QString NumberOfTabForTabWidget=QString::number(GlobalVaribles::NumberOfTab);
    TabWidget->addTab(MainTabWidget,NumberOfTabForTabWidget);
    TabWidget->setCurrentWidget(MainTabWidget);
    TabWidget->currentWidget()->setLayout(MainTabVBoxLayout);
 
}
 
void OTS_MainWindow::ChosenQuestionEvent(int)
{
 
    Q=new Question;
    if (QuestionTabWidget->currentIndex()>-1)
        {
            if (TypeOfQuestionComboBox->currentIndex()==1)
                {
                 /*Присваиваю элементу нужное мне значение*/ 
                    GlobalVaribles::SummOfTabAndTypeOfQuestionForCurrentTab[QuestionTabWidget->currentIndex()]=TypeOfQuestionComboBox->currentIndex();
                    DeleteAllWidgets(QuestionTabWidget->currentWidget()->layout());
                    Q->SingleOrManyVariantsQuestionForm(QuestionTabWidget);
                }
            delete Q;
        }
    else
        QMessageBox::information(0,tr("information"),tr("No tabs for adding"),QMessageBox::Ok|QMessageBox::NoButton);
}
При попытке это сделать программа завершаетс с кодом -1073741819.
Больше ни аких сообщений не выдает. В че может быть проблема?
Заранее всем спасибо.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ru